Hey folks — handing off LiftPath release duties to Mara while I'm out. The elevator-dispatch simulator ships Thursdays; build 4.2 is staged and the scenario packs are frozen. Only gotcha: the dispatch-core artifact won't promote unless it's signed before the smoke suite kicks off, so do that first, not after. Everything else is in the runbook on the Ostermill wiki. Mara, you'll need the deploy key to push to the release channel, so pasting it here for the sync notes.

deploy key for tawip-bawig: bky13_1zSxDtVxnNkjh

Subject: Key rotation — Relevix tuning service

Team,

The old key for the Relevix relevance-tuning API is revoked as of today. All scripts pulling ranking experiments or pushing boost-weight notes must switch immediately. Contractors: update your local config before running any tuning jobs, or writes will silently fail and your notes won't land in the shared corpus. The replacement key is below.

gateway credential: kto23_LX9A4ys6i4nzHtpOLNLodKK

## Build Provenance: Clinic Reminder Job

Quick note for the release manager: the Tansybrook appointment reminder job is now built through the Quillgate pipeline, so every artifact carries signed provenance. No more mystery jars from someone's laptop. If a patient reminder batch misfires, you can trace it straight back to the commit. The currently deployed build is identified by the token below.

build token for yajof-bajof: htk31_506ff1188f74596b5bb2eec94edc43c